A new map of Maryland and Delaware.

Map shows mid-nineteenth century Maryland and Delaware counties, cities and towns, "stage" roads, railroads, canals, marshlands, and distances. Inset: Baltimore street names, parks, buildings, and wards. Includes legend "explanation" of symbols on map, reference key on inset, and table of steam boat routes. Prime meridian: Washington. Relief shown by hachures. Scale [ca. 1:1,150,000].
Date: 1846
Creator: Mitchell, S. Augustus (Samuel Augustus), 1792-1868

Plan of Baltimore [1874].

Map shows numbered wards, street names, parks, railroads, buildings, and some institutions in mid-nineteenth century Baltimore, Maryland. On verso: "County map of Maryland and Delaware, drawn and engraved by W.H. Gamble" and "County map of New Jersey." Relief shown by hachures on verso. Scale not given.
Date: 1874
Creator: Mitchell, S. Augustus, Jr. (Samuel Augustus)
